5 AAC 27.462 - Reporting requirements for Cook Inlet Area
(a) In addition to
the requirements of
5
AAC 39.130(n), a buyer, buyer's
agent, or fisherman who has arranged for the tendering of the fisherman's own
catch, operating in the Southern, Kamishak Bay, Barren Island, Outer, and
Eastern Districts, shall report in person to and register with a local
representative of the department before commencing operations. The buyer,
buyer's agent, or fisherman who has arranged for the tendering of the
fisherman's own catch shall
(1) identify and
describe all vessels to be employed in transporting or processing
herring;
(2) report daily, or as
otherwise specified by a local department representative, all herring purchased
from fishermen, or other processing records as specified by a department
representative; and
(3) submit
fully completed fish tickets with accurate and final weight and roe percentages
no later than 10 days after termination of buying operations in the area, or as
otherwise specified by a local representative of the department.
(b) When herring is taken in the
Kamishak District by a CFEC permit holder, each person, buyer, company, firm,
or other organization that is the first purchaser of herring, and that is
required to record and submit a fish ticket under
5
AAC 39.130(c) shall record on the
fish ticket, in addition to the other information required by the ticket, the
(1) on-the-fishing ground weight of herring
measured by the most efficient method possible, such as dump boxes, scales, or
totes, with weight in tons or pounds; and
(2) estimated roe percentage of the herring
as determined by a regular sampling of the catch; the sampling shall test
approximately 10 kilograms of herring for each five to 10 tons of herring
delivered.
(c) A copy of
the fish ticket required under (b) of this section must be provided at the time
of delivery to the CFEC permit holder by the person, buyer, company, firm, or
other organization that is the first purchaser of herring that is taken in the
Kamishak District.
Notes
Authority:AS 16.05.251
